Location: South Carolina (Hybrid Work Available)
A law firm seeks a motivated Associate Attorney with 1-3 years of litigation experience to join its dynamic civil defense team. This role provides the opportunity to work on complex legal matters, collaborate with seasoned professionals, and contribute to a thriving legal practice. The firm fosters a supportive and inclusive environment that values professional growth, mentorship, and work-life balance.
Represent clients in litigation matters, including court hearings, motions, and trials
Conduct legal research and draft pleadings, motions, and briefs
Manage case files and deadlines efficiently
Provide strategic legal counsel to clients and maintain strong client relationships
Engage in discovery, including depositions, interrogatories, and document review
Work collaboratively with partners and colleagues to develop legal strategies
Attend firm-sponsored professional development and networking events
Maintain up-to-date knowledge of relevant laws and legal trends
1-3 years of litigation experience (civil defense preferred)
Strong legal research and writing skills
Excellent communication and advocacy abilities
Ability to manage multiple cases and deadlines effectively
Team-oriented with a proactive approach to legal practice
High attention to detail and analytical problem-solving skills
Ability to work under pressure and thrive in a fast-paced environment
Juris Doctor (J.D.) from an accredited law school
Licensed to practice law in South Carolina
